
A new update has been released for Trackmania update 1.11. You can find all the details of the game update, bug fixes, improvements and patch notes below. Trackmania Update 1.11 is now available to download for all platforms including PS4, PS5, Xbox One, Xbox Series S/X, and PC. The file size may vary depending on the platform.
- The current official campaign now has an unlock system to offer better progression for players. To unlock the blue slopes you will need the first 10 bronze medals, to unlock the red slopes the first 15 silver medals and to unlock the black slopes the first 20 gold medals. Tracks can still be played in other parts of the game without limitations.

HOW TO PLAY
- Ice game has been improved. There should no longer be a slowdown and ripples should no longer be exploitative. The ice game is also a bit faster.
- Reduce the time before you can brake again after a water bounce.
- Fix car spinning by itself when landing a jump in brittle mode.
ACCESSIBILITY
- Improved the onboarding menu when you first start the game.
- Add a setting to choose the size of the text chat.
- Add a setting to display a background behind the text chat.
- Add a scroll in text chat to view older messages on the large chat screen.
- Text-to-Speech now reads the latest messages displayed in text chat when displayed large.
- With a new Text-to-speech setting turned on, voice chat users will read a typed message in chat. (English only)
- Add text to speech in the report popup.

NEW BLOCKS AND OBJECTS (PC TRACK EDITOR ONLY)
- 38 Narrow blocks (12 RoadTech, 12 RoadDirt and 14 RoadIce).
- 10 Platform Curve 4 and 5 blocks (2 PlatformTech, 2 PlatformDirt, 2 PlatformGrass, 2 PlatformIce, 2 PlatformPlastic).
- 1 Pillar (DecoWallCurve5)
